Job Overview
Jensen Hughes is seeking a full-time Transportation Consultant, who is based in one of our offices within Canada. Remote working can be considered as dictated by personal circumstances. The Consultant will focus on pedestrian planning and modelling and work with a multi-disciplinary team to consult with clients on upgrading existing transportation infrastructure and delivering future demand in major rapid rail transit projects.
Only candidates based in Canada will be considered.
Responsibilities
Design and lead pedestrian modelling approaches primarily for rapid rail transit projects
Provide pedestrian flow analysis using a wide variety of evaluation techniques from business case study, design feasibility study and detailed design stages of projects
Lead the preparation and writing of technical reports detailing modelling approach, calibration and results
Present modelling approaches and results to clients, the public and other technical and non-technical audiences
Undertake various project management duties such as managing projects, client engagement, work planning, budget monitoring, and project reporting
Participate with other Jensen Hughes staff in business development, as well as the promotion of advancing market growth opportunities
Participate in training and working on a wide variety of fire protection engineering design and consulting projects
Requirements and Qualifications
Bachelor's or Master's degree in Transportation Engineering (or other related engineering discipline), Planning, Economics, Geography or similar
5 - 10 years of previous experience that includes extensive experience in leading pedestrian modelling projects and initiatives
Skilled in applying the Fruin's Level of Service concept, general pedestrian flow and dynamic people movement/behavior
Proficiency in one or more pedestrian modelling tools including MassMotion, Legion Space Works, Viswalk or others
Experience in using Auto CAD software for model layout preparation
Excellent presentation, communication and technical writing skills
An entrepreneurial spirit and inclination toward developing transportation modelling-based opportunities for the business
Willingness to learn fire protection discipline from experts on the team
Proficient in Microsoft Office Applications (Word, Excel, PowerPoint)
Professional Engineer and/or Registered Professional Planner is an asset
